What are the benefits of coloring Ghost dancing at Halloween party Coloring Page?

Coloring this page is a fantastic way to get into the Halloween spirit without any fright! The friendly theme helps children see Halloween as a fun and joyful holiday rather than a scary one. Technically, this page is excellent for developing f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ination. The variety of shapes—from the round pumpkins to the pointy stars and curvy spiderwebs—requires the colorist to constantly adjust their hand movements. It also encourages decision-making and creativity. Children must decide how to make the white ghost stand out against the busy background, perhaps by choosing a contrasting dark color for the sky. This helps them learn about color contrast and spatial awareness.

What are the best color suggestions for Ghost dancing at Halloween party Coloring Page?

Since the ghost is the star of the show, try leaving him white! To make him look 3D, you can use a very light grey or pale blue crayon to gently shade the edges of his sheet. For the background, use bold, contrasting colors. A deep purple or midnight blue background will make the white ghost and orange pumpkins really pop out! Don't forget the pumpkins! You can make them bright orange, but try coloring their eyes and mouths yellow to look like there are candles glowing inside them. For the leaves, mix it up with reds, browns, and golds to show it is Autumn. Finally, use bright neon colors like pink or lime green for the candies and party streamers to make the party look super fun!
